Subject: Handover — Lattermill template rendering perf

Hi, as you review the 3.9 branch: the template renderer now precompiles partials and caches them per locale, cutting render time roughly 40% on the Bryce dashboards. Watch the cache invalidation path carefully — stale partials were our worst regression last quarter. Benchmarks are in the perf folder. Release builds must be signed; the current deploy key follows.

signing key of bagap-yawep = bky13_TbfT6ZMUoGJo2

// Security reviewer notes: deliveries retry on 5xx and network errors only,
// with exponential backoff (base 2s, cap 10m, max 8 attempts). 4xx responses
// are terminal — we never retry client rejections, which prevents replay
// amplification against a misconfigured endpoint. Each attempt re-signs the
// payload with a fresh timestamp; receivers must reject signatures older
// than 5 minutes. Dead-lettered events require manual, audited redelivery.
// The build this policy was verified against is recorded below.

trace token, kahog-tajeg: htk6_97d963

Minutes — Management Meeting, Capacity Decision

The board reviewed output constraints at the Greywick plant. Demand for the Solmere line exceeds current capacity by roughly 15%. Options discussed: a third shift versus expanding the Ashdell facility. Finance presented cost models; operations favoured the shift addition as lower risk. A final decision follows the context stated below.

board note of bawep-tajef: Queniusek Systems plans to raise the Quenvan list price by 53.1 percent in March. The pricing group signed off on a budget of $176.4 million for Project Drueth. The renewal with Casionix Partners closes at $142.5 million a year, 8.3 percent below the last contract. Project Fraax slips by six weeks because of the tooling delay.

**Ticket: Reconcile job double-counts transfers — WarehouseWrangler**

Welcome, new folks — this one's a good starter. The nightly inventory reconciliation job on WarehouseWrangler counts inter-depot transfers twice when the source and destination depots finish scanning in the same batch window. Net effect: phantom surplus in the Tuesday reports. Suspect the dedupe key only uses SKU + timestamp, not depot pair. Repro steps are in the attached runbook. Grab the failing nightly run from the logs using the run token below.

pipeline stamp: htk4_ae36